Determination of Dissociation Constants of Resverastrol and Polydatin by Capillary Zone Electrophoresis

Abstract

A method to determine the dissociation constants of resverastrol and polydatin by capillary zone electrophoresis was developed. First, resverastrol and polydatin have to be baseline separated to measure their effective electrophoretic mobilities accurately. Second, the first order dissociation constants of resverastrol and polydatin, which are 9.49 and 9.40, can be obtained from the non‐linear regression between their effective electrophoretic mobilities and the H+ activities of the running buffer. The correlation coefficients of the non‐linear regression are 0.9956 and 0.9982, respectively. The reliability of the method is validated by the result of the hydroquinone of which the first order dissociation constant is known.
